| Erreurs avec une application BOINC ? |
|
|
|
| Écrit par otax | |
| 10-04-2008 | |
|
Vous avez un problème avec une application
Voici une petite aide qui peut vous sortir de là. Il s'agit de vérifier que toutes les dépendances d'une application sont bien résolues. En termes plus windowsiens, qu'il ne vous manque pas quelque chose de nécessaire (une librairie, un module, etc ...) à la bonne marche de l'application du projet en question.
Il faut tout d'abord se rendre dans le dossier du projet. Dans cet exemple, le dossier BOINC est dans mon dossier perso (otax), et le projet est Leiden (Gorlaeus). Utilisez votre navigateur de fichier pour trouver rapidement où cela se trouve. Ensuite ouvrez votre console et allez dans le dossier du projet :
Là on peut repérer les noms des applications (avec la commande ls par exemple) : ici c'est celle-là : classical_5.49_x86_64-pc-linux-gnu.exe (que l'on peut aussi repérer dans la liste des processus quand elle tourne).
La commande magique est ldd (List Dynamic Dependencies) . Il faut l'utiliser sur le nom de l'application dont vous voulez vérifier les dépendances. Donc :
La réponse sera une liste de tout ce qui lui est nécessaire :
libglut.so.3 => /usr/lib/libglut.so.3 (0x00002b98526f8000)
Dans le cas présent il me manque un paquet (not found). Il suffira de chercher ce paquet dans la liste des paquets installables. S'il n'est pas disponible, chercher sur Google pour voir si vous devez ajouter un nouveau dépôt à votre liste de sources ....
|
|
| Dernière mise à jour : ( 15-04-2008 ) |
| Suivant > |
|---|




BOINC


